Recent EIA Short-Term Energy Outlook revisions highlight record U.S. natural gas production and reduced LNG feedgas demand as the dominant forces capping Henry Hub prices near $2.88/MMBtu in late August 2026. High storage inventories, projected to reach record levels by October, have prompted the agency to lower its Q3 2026 average forecast to $2.87/MMBtu, with futures contracts through September remaining below $3.00. These fundamentals align with seasonal shoulder-period dynamics and elevated five-year storage averages, limiting near-term upside. The next EIA update on September 9 and any shifts in weather-driven demand or export volumes represent the key near-term catalysts that could influence trader positioning on price thresholds by month-end.
